Transaction 87ac841ecb680d82a742546606a24e5289716cf0e58c7921b3e756613c192314
1 Input
1 Output
-
87ac841ecb680d82a742546606a24e5289716cf0e58c7921b3e756613c192314:0
- value
- 2078784
- script pubkey
- OP_0 OP_PUSHBYTES_20 d7da75cd12e90a707719aa294a36992940c8f256
- address
- bc1q6ld8tngjay98qace4g555d5e99qv3ujklaqtsl